Joel Embiid has triple-double for 76ers in return after missing 15 games
Joel Embiid hopes his return to the lineup isn't just a one-day thing. The injury-plagued Philadelphia 76ers center showed no rust in his return from a left knee injury that sidelined him for a month, recording his first triple-double of the season Tuesday night in a victory over the Dallas Mavericks. Embiid — who missed the previous 15 games — had 29 points, 11 rebounds and 10 assists in the Sixers’ 118-116 win.

No. 21 Wisconsin breezes past Indiana 76-64 to beat Hoosiers in Madison for 21st straight time
John Tonje had 15 points to lead a balanced scoring attack and No. 21 Wisconsin continued its home domination of Indiana by beating the slumping Hoosiers 76-64 on Tuesday night. Wisconsin (18-5, 8-4 Big Ten) has won its last 21 home games against Indiana, the Hoosiers’ longest road losing streak against any opponent. The Hoosiers’ last victory over the Badgers in Madison came on Jan. 25, 1998, in the inaugural season of the Kohl Center.

In shock announcement, Trump says U.S. wants to take over Gaza Strip
President Donald Trump said the U.S. would take over the war-ravaged Gaza Strip and develop it economically after Palestinians are resettled elsewhere, actions that would shatter decades of U.S. policy toward the Israeli-Palestinian conflict. Trump unveiled his surprise plan, without providing specifics, at a joint press conference on Tuesday with visiting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u. The announcement followed Trump's shock proposal earlier on Tuesday for the permanent resettlement of the more than two million Palestinians from Gaza to neighboring countries, calling the enclave - where the first phase of a fragile Israel-Hamas ceasefire and hostage release deal is in effect - a "demolition site."

Trump says he wants Ukraine to supply US with rare earths
WASHINGTON (Reuters) -U.S. President Donald Trump said on Monday he wants Ukraine to supply the United States with rare earth minerals as a form of payment for financially supporting the country's war efforts against Russia. Trump, speaking to reporters at the White House, said Ukraine was willing, adding that he wants "equalization" from Ukraine for Washington's "close to $300 billion" in support. "We're telling Ukraine they have very valuable rare earths," Trump said.

IS prisoners facing unknown fate in Syrian prisons
Men of various ages and nationalities sit silently in their cells in a Syrian prison. All are alleged members of the Islamic State group, captured during the final days of the extremists' so-called caliphate declared in large parts of Iraq and Syria. The Associated Press was given a rare visit to the prison where security of the centre is a growing question since the fall of the Assad dynasty.
